Jacob Fox vs. Brian Smith — Career Comparison
Looking at the career totals, Jacob Fox and Brian Smith are fairly close on the surface numbers. Brian Smith posted stronger numbers in ERA (10.38 vs 18) and WHIP (1.846 vs 3.000). Jacob Fox had the advantage in home runs allowed (0 per nine innings vs 2.08). By the career numbers, Brian Smith had the better of this comparison — though ERA and WHIP alone don't account for era, park factors, or the defenses each pitcher worked behind.
